Transaction 93fef84589d78d068a30c643acc569d3647362a8ef7556f2086721d7fc1f4a45
1 Input
1 Output
-
93fef84589d78d068a30c643acc569d3647362a8ef7556f2086721d7fc1f4a45:0
- value
- 67798
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1baed7b4ddc5318e202cd6cbda2733e826fe15ae OP_EQUAL
- address
- 34DPczy59wZZAi5EmcPnb5CYVmqU1BNvkW